SUMMARY:Online Energy Minimization Under A Peak Age of Information Constrai
 nt
DESCRIPTION:Speaker: Kumar Saurav\n\nAbstract: \nWe consider a node where p
 ackets of fixed size are generated at arbitrary intervals. The node is req
 uired to maintain the peak age of information (AoI) at the monitor below a
  threshold by transmitting potentially a subset of the generated packets. 
 At any time\, depending on packet availability and current AoI\, the node 
 can choose the packet to transmit\, and its transmission speed. We conside
 r a power function (rate of energy consumption) that is increasing and con
 vex in transmission speed\, and the objective is to minimize the energy co
 nsumption under the peak AoI constraint at all times. For this problem\, w
 e propose a (customized) greedy policy\, and analyze its competitive ratio
  (CR) by comparing it against an optimal offline policy by deriving some s
 tructural results. We show that for polynomial power functions\, the CR up
 per bound for the greedy policy is independent of the system parameters\, 
 such as the peak AoI\, packet size\, time horizon\, or the number of packe
 ts generated. Also\, we derive a lower bound on the competitive ratio of a
 ny causal policy\, and show that for exponential power functions (e.g.\, S
 hannon rate function)\, the competitive ratio of any causal policy grows e
 xponentially with increase in the ratio of packet size to peak AoI.\n\nThi
 s talk is based on the joint work with Prof. Rahul Vaze\, set to appear in
